Графика для Windows средствами DirectDraw

       

Поверхности и форматы пикселей

  1. Палитровые поверхности

  2. Поверхности High Color

  3. Поверхности True Color

  4. Загрузка графических данных на поверхность

  5. Использование диалоговых окон Windows в DirectDraw

    Наверное, это самая важная глава во всей книге. Она посвящена поверхностям, а поверхности — главное, для чего создавалась библиотека DirectDraw. Поверхности DirectDraw позволяют хранить изображения, копировать и изменять их, переключать кадры и выводить графическую информацию на экран. Все интерфейсы DirectDraw в первую очередь ориентированы на работу с поверхностями. Интерфейс DirectDrawPalette облегчает интерпретацию палитровых поверхностей; интерфейс DirectDrawClipper определяет, какая часть (или части) поверхности будут копироваться при блиттинге; наконец, сам интерфейс DirectDraw обеспечивает основные средства для работы с поверхностями.



    Содержание раздела